Mobley won't play Sunday against the Pacers due to low back soreness. Mobley recorded a 16-point, 10-rebound double-double against the Knicks on Friday, and the star forward, who earned an All-Star nod for the first time in his career this season, won't be available for the season finale. That way, he'll end his breakout year with averages of 18.5 points, 9.3 rebounds, 3.2 assists, 1.6 blocks and 0.9 steals per game across 71 contests. Mobley will have almost an entire week to rest before the start of the 2025 NBA Playoffs on April 19.... See More ... See Less

Cavaliers' Evan Mobley: Tallies 20-10 double-double in win
Mobley ended Tuesday's 135-113 win over Chicago with 21 points (8-18 FG, 3-6 3Pt, 2-2 FT), 12 rebounds, seven assists, one block and two steals over 29 minutes. Mobley put forth a well-rounded performance in Tuesday's contest, leading all players in rebounds and assists while posting the lone double-double of the contest in a winning effort. Mobley has recorded at least 20 points, 10 rebounds and five assists in nine outings this season, including in two of his last three performances.... See More ... See Less -
Cavaliers' Evan Mobley: Stuffs stat sheet Sunday
Mobley had 16 points (7-14 FG, 0-4 3Pt, 2-5 FT), nine rebounds, four assists, two blocks and three steals over 33 minutes during Sunday's 120-113 loss to the Kings. Mobley stuffed the stat sheet Sunday, leading the Cavaliers in swats and swipes. Over his last nine appearances, the All-Star big man has averaged 18.2 points, 9.2 rebounds, 3.7 assists, 2.2 blocks, 0.8 steals and 1.8 three-pointers in 31.8 minutes while shooting 52.9 percent from the floor. Mobley is converting just 64.5 percent of his free-throw attempts during this interval, which has been about the only shortcoming that's prevented him from being a complete nine-category fantasy superstar in 2024-25.... Cavaliers' Evan Mobley: Poor shooting display
Mobley ended Friday's 133-122 loss to the Pistons with nine points (3-10 FG, 2-6 3Pt, 1-2 FT), six rebounds, four assists and two blocks across 33 minutes. Donovan Mitchell and Darius Garland posted solid numbers across the board in this loss Friday, but Mobley was one player who disappointed. The star forward had a rough showing on offense, and he also failed to make an impact in secondary categories, with perhaps the two blocks being the only figure that stood out from his overall fantasy line. Mobley is having a career-best season in 2024-25, but he's been turning things in the opposite direction of late. He's failed to reach the 20-point mark in four of his last six appearances, a span in which he's averaging 17.5 points per game while shooting 34.8 percent from three-point range.... See More ...
